Babylon Berlin - Season 1

Season 1
A Soviet freight train's hijacking leads a haunted cop and a poor typist to uncover a political conspiracy amid the vice and glamour of 1929 Berlin.
Episodes

Episode 1
In 1929, a freight train traveling from the Soviet Union is hijacked. Meanwhile, Chief Inspector Gereon Rath from Cologne pursues a mission in Berlin.

Episode 2
Rath attempts to interrogate König further regarding the missing film reel, while the Russian revolutionaries' location is revealed by an informant.

Episode 3
Kardakov flees after the Soviet attack on The Red Fortress. Rath receives an uninvited guest in his apartment.

Episode 4
The May Day stand-off between communist protesters and police erupts in bloody violence.

Episode 5
As Berlin becomes increasingly politically charged, those in charge look to change the discourse on the May Day violence.

Episode 6
Kardakov seeks help in retrieving the Sorokins' gold. Rath faces a moral dilemma, and Bruno makes a power play.

Episode 7
Lotte's private investigation leads her to the depot where the hijacked train is held. Rath relives painful memories of the front.

Episode 8
Rath and Bruno finally get a lead to the location of the missing film reel, but after the truth come the consequences.
